Overview

Applied Smelting is an add-on for Applied Energistics 2 that integrates furnace processing directly into your ME network. Instead of moving items between storage and separate furnaces, this mod lets you smelt, blast, smoke, and melt materials using network-powered machines, all controlled from a single terminal.

Machines and Tiers

Applied Smelting introduces four machine families: the ME Smelter for furnace recipes, the ME Blast Furnace for blasting recipes, the ME Smoker for smoking recipes, and the ME Crucible for turning ores and raw metals into molten fluids. Each machine comes in four tiers - Default, Mk1, Mk2, and Mk3 - offering increasing speed, efficiency, and queue capacity. You can upgrade machines in place using a universal upgrade-kit chain, preserving pinned recipes, progress, fuel, cards, power mode, and network assignment.

ME Smelting Terminal

The ME Smelting Terminal provides a single interface to control all four processing queues - Smelting, Blasting, Smoking, and Crucible. From this terminal, you can view live progress, set output targets, select fuel, and see aggregate machine status across your network.

Power and Fuel Options

Each machine supports three power modes: conventional furnace fuel, AE power drawn from your network, or lava from ME fluid storage. Here's the thing, this flexibility lets you choose the most efficient energy source for your setup.

Upgrade Cards

Using AE2's standard upgrade slot system, you can install Acceleration, Energy, Fuel Efficiency, Capacity, and Redstone cards to tune speed, power draw, fuel duration, queue size, and redstone behavior per machine.

Pinned Processing and Scheduling

Right-click a machine with a valid input to pin it to that recipe, dedicating it to that task instead of the shared network queue. Multiple machines on the same network share a work queue and process different recipes in parallel.

Integration and Compatibility

Applied Smelting offers optional JEI integration to expose Crucible recipes and register every machine tier as a recipe catalyst. Jade support provides tooltips showing status, input, progress, and fuel without opening a menu. The Crucible uses fluids from common c:molten_ tags when another mod provides them, falling back to its own network-only fluids otherwise.

Requirements

  • Minecraft 26.1.2
  • NeoForge 26.1.2.80 or a newer compatible 26.1 build
  • Applied Energistics 2 26.1.10-beta or a newer compatible 26.1 release
  • Java 25
  • Optional: JEI 29.16.0.47+, Jade 26.1.0+

Current Status

Applied Smelting is in active development. Features, recipes, balance, interfaces, and artwork may change before the first stable release. Recent updates have focused on network-wide scheduling, flexible fuel selection, and a clearer terminal interface, with recipe browsing and more advanced processing controls planned for future releases.
